Valassis Wins Five WebAwards from the Web Marketing Association

Press release from the issuing company

LIVONIA, Mich., Oct. 3 -- Valassis, the leading company in marketing services and Connective Media, announced today that the Web Marketing Association (WMA), an organization working to create a high standard of excellence for Web site development and marketing on the Internet, named three Web sites designed by Valassis as 2006 WebAward recipients. More than 2,300 sites from 35 countries were judged during this year's WebAward competition. "We are extremely proud of our e-marketing creative and Web site development accomplishments because they are helping our clients grow their businesses," said Ron Goolsby, Vice President of Valassis 1 to 1 Solutions. "It is an honor to receive an award as prestigious as this, especially by the Web Marketing Association." The IKEA Canton Project Web site (http://www.ikeacantonproject.com/archive ) received the Online Community Standard of Excellence WebAward and the Retail Standard of Excellence WebAward. Valassis designed the IKEA Canton Project Web site to allow the client to track user involvement and calculate participation points and referrals. The concept for the site came from the growing popularity of online social networks, allowing people with similar interests to connect with each other. The Hastings Summer Book Club site (http://www.readhastings.com ) received the Family Standard of Excellence WebAward and the Retail Standard of Excellence WebAward. Valassis created the Hastings Summer Book Club site to align with Hastings Entertainment's in-store book club targeted to kids aged 2 to 18. The site included four monthly themes with engaging illustrations, a book review submission tool and book quizzes -- all to keep kids excited about reading all summer long. The In Step with SYNVISC site (https://www.instepwithsynvisc.com ) received a Pharmaceuticals Standard of Excellence WebAward. The site was designed by Valassis to support a relationship marketing program that offers osteoarthritis patients information to better manage their condition and decide if SYNVISC is right for them. According to the WMA, the Standard of Excellence awards are given to sites that set the level that corporate Web sites should strive to achieve. Web sites are judged on design, ease of use, copywriting, interactivity, use of technology, innovation and content. Judges included members of the media, advertising executives, site designers, creative directors, corporate marketing executives, content providers and webmasters.
